Rodney Jon Willemsen

Source: Eilders, Berend, "Eilders and Eilderts Family from Germany (Ost-Friesland), The Netherlands and the USA," (Pub. location unknown, http://wc.rootsweb.ancestry.com/cgi-bin/igm.cgi?op=GET&db=eilders-eilderts&id=I77013, xix Dec MMXI)

"... Rodney WILLEMSEN Sex: M Death: BEF 2008

Father: Living WILLEMSEN Mother: Karlene KOENEN b: 20 SEP 1947 in Hampton, Franklin County, Iowa"

Knock, Marvin, "Knock Family, (Sioux Fls., SD, http://wc.rootsweb.ancestry.com/cgi-bin/igm.cgi?op=GET&db=knock&id=I400920&style=TABLE, xxvii Oct MMX)

"... Rodney Jon WILLEMSEN ... Sex: M Birth: 10 Aug 1968 in Oklahoma City, Oklahoma County, Oklahoma, USA Death: 29 Oct 1968 in Oklahoma City, Oklahoma County, Oklahoma, USA Burial: 31 Oct 1968 Sheffield, Franklin County, Iowa, USA ADDR:Zion Reformed Church Cemetery - Sheffield, IA Franklin County ... Change Date: 27 Oct 2010 ...

Father: Living WILLEMSEN Mother: Living KOENEN" <>
